Does anyone feel sorry for a suspected rhino poacher who was killed by elephants and eaten by lions?

I don’t.Let me explain.I was raised in the village named Ngoreme, in the outskirts of Serengeti National Park in Tanzania. Poachers were part of our community as we shared the border with the park. We knew them by names, their families etc.Our community hated poachers because the village will get frequent raids from the Government forces or game rangers looking for them. People will get hurt in these operations and sometimes innocent people will die.In my experience, poachers are not your normal peasants looking for something to eat inside the park. These are people who go hunting carrying the AK47’s, RPG, Submachine guns and of course the powerful .458 or .375.These are some part of their operations, forget animals poaching part for a moment.A village leader tried to prevent local poachers from killing animals in Tarangire National Park, he became their next target.A British pilot who was murdered by poachers. Roger Gower was shot while in the air tracking poachers in Serengeti National Park.A South African, Wayne Lotter, faced the same fate - murdered by poachers.63 headcounts for 2018 - again, poachers.So now you get the idea of why people are celebrating what animals did to this scumbag -poachers don’t kill animals only- the reason we have a shoot to kill policy for poachers in my country.EDIT 1:Botswana, another peaceful African country like Tanzania, has a similar policy for poachers - shoot-to-kill.EDIT 2: Another day at the office.
